Abstract
"CONJUNTO DE CONECTOR E PROCESSOS PARA PRODUZIR POR MOLDAGEM POR INJEçãO, UMA COMBINAçãO DE UM ELEMENTO FêMEA E UM SOQUETE ADAPTADOR OU DE UM ELEMENTO MACHO E UMA PEçA DE ACOPLAMENTO". Um conjunto de conector para opcionalmente permitir um meio livremente fluente a passar compreende: um elemento fêmea oco (1) com uma parede de fechamento transversal (9) e aberturas de passagem (11) que são formadas na parede lateral, um elemento macho (3) que pode ser inserido no interior do elemento fêmea (1) e pode ser acoplado com o mesmo, um soquete adaptador (5), no interior do qual o elemento fêmea (1) pode ser deslocado na direção axial entre uma posição na qual fecha o fluxo do meio fluente e na qual as aberturas de passagem (11) são fechadas pelo soquete adaptador (5), e uma posição na qual permite o meio a passar e na qual as aberturas de passagem (11) não são fechadas pelo soquete adaptador (5). O elemento fêmea (1) é provido, a uma distância da parede de fechamento transversal (9), de dispositivos de conexão (17) que podem formar uma conexão com dispositivos de conexão (355) dispostos sobre o elemento macho (3) e/ou a peça de acoplamento (7) que é acoplada com o mesmo. Como um resultado de atuação do elemento macho (3) e/ou da peça de acoplamento (7) que está acoplada com o mesmo, o elemento fêmea (1) pode ser deslocado entre a posição acima mencionada na qual fecha a passagem do meio fluente e a posição acima mencionada na qual permite a passagem do meio fluente, em cuja última posição os dispositivos de conexão (17, 55) do elemento fêmea (1) são acomodados em uma cavidade relativamente estreita (28) no soquete adaptador (5), de modo a formar uma conexão com o elemento macho (3) e/ou a peça de acoplamento (7) que está acoplada com o mesmo, ao passo que na posição acima mencionada na qual o fluxo do meio é impedido, os dispositivos de conexão (17, 55) são acomodados em uma cavidade relativamente larga (32) no soquete adaptador (5), com o resultado de que a conexão entre o elemento fêmea (1) e o elemento macho (3) e/ou a peça de acoplamento (7) que é acoplada com o mesmo pode ser desfeita. Enquanto o acoplamento entre o elemento fêmea (1) e o elemento macho (3) e/ou a peça de acoplamento (7) que é acoplada com o mesmo está sendo causado, os dispositivos de conexão (17,355) são situados na cavidade ampla (32) no soquete adaptador (5), em um espaço livre no seu interior.
